Excel Power Query fails to connect to salesforce
christophelel FYI, opened support tickets with SF and MS. SF says this is MS' problem. MS says to try rolling Excel back to version 2005. Haven't tested myself but here you go:
Please perform the following for installation of version 2005, please also choose the version correctly.
Office Deployment Tool Installation
1. Download the Office Deployment Tool (https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=49117)
2. Open the downloaded file and extract it to an easily accessible location. i.e. create a folder named ODT in Drive C (C:\ODT)
3. Create Configuration file by going to https://config.office.com select "Create" new configuration file. Sample Below
a. Architecture: 32-bit
b. Office Suites: Office 365 Business
c. Update Channel: Semi-Annual, Latest
d. Languages: Match Operating System
e. Installation: Office Content Delivery Network (CDN)
Note: For options not in sample, no need to make changes on them
4. Click on Export on upper right
5. Check "I accept" then click Export
6. Copy the configuration.xml file downloaded and paste it to C:\ODT and replace existing file if conflict occurs
7. Open Command Prompt with admin rights
8. Change directory to ODT folder by running:
a. Cd C:\ODT
9. Type "setup.exe /download configuration.xml" and hit Enter
10. After download has finished, type "setup.exe /configure configuration.xml" then hit enter and wait for the installation to finish
